Why Azusa’s Climate & Housing Affect Garage Doors

Azusa sits directly at the mouth of San Gabriel Canyon - locally called “the Canyon City” - where mountain winds funnel down and accelerate onto residential streets in a way that simply doesn’t happen in neighboring flatland cities like our Covina service area or Baldwin Park. This canyon-wind loading puts chronic stress on garage door torsion springs, panel seams, and bottom weather seals, making wind-rated door panels and reinforced horizontal track brackets a far more common upgrade conversation here than anywhere a few miles to the west or east.

The housing stock compounds the issue. Azusa’s residential core is dominated by post-WWII tract homes from the 1950s and 1960s, many still equipped with original single-car garages featuring outdated extension spring systems, wood sectional doors warped from decades of Inland Valley heat cycles, and narrow 8-foot openings that owners frequently want widened to accommodate modern SUVs. The older bungalow belt near downtown Azusa adds an additional layer of aging hardware - sometimes including swing-out carriage doors converted mid-century - that requires specialty hardware sourcing.

At roughly 600 feet elevation, Azusa also gets Santa Ana wind events amplified by that canyon gap. Gusts exceed 60 mph at street level and repeatedly rack single-layer steel doors off their tracks. Summer temperatures past 100°F accelerate lubricant breakdown in springs and rollers, and PVC weather seals crack and shrink faster than in coastal LA. Technicians working the north Azusa streets closest to the canyon mouth - near Foothill Boulevard and the neighborhoods backing up toward the Angeles National Forest boundary - consistently find that springs and cables fail earlier than their rated cycles suggest. Quoting upgraded spring tension ratings and wind-load-rated panels is almost a baseline expectation for jobs in that corridor.

Pricing for Garage Door Services in Azusa

These ranges reflect what we quote for typical Azusa jobs. Every estimate is free and itemized before work starts.

Service Typical Range
Spring repair (torsion or extension) $180 - $340
Cable replacement $140 - $220
Track realignment or section replacement $160 - $280
Opener repair (gear, sensor, logic board) $120 - $350
Opener replacement (installed) $450 - $850
New steel door installation (single, standard) $1,200 - $2,200
New door with wind-rated panels / insulation $2,400 - $3,800
Bottom weather seal replacement $85 - $150

Wind-rated upgrades and spring tension increases for canyon-exposed homes add $80-$200 to base repair pricing. We’ll tell you if your location warrants it before quoting.
